WebMay 22, 2024 · According to the American Short Line and Regional Railroad Association (ASLRRA), those categories are: Class I railroads: annual operating revenue over $489.9 million. Class II railroads: annual operating revenue between $39.2 million and $489.9 million. Class III railroads: annual operating revenue of less than $39.2 million. WebDec 27, 2024 · Currently there are about 15 Class II (Regional) railroads that are still in service in the United States. WebThe STB's current definition of a Class I railroad was set in 1992, that being any carrier earning annual revenue greater than $250 million. This has since been adjusted for inflation and most recently set to $504,803,294 in 2024. ... One internet article said in 1980 there were 40 class 1 railroads. great clips medford njInitially (in 1911) the Interstate Commerce Commission (ICC) classified railroads by their annual gross revenue. Class I railroads had an annual operating revenue of at least $1 million, while Class III railroad incomes were under $100,000 per annum. All such corporations were subject to reporting requirements on a quarterly or annual schedule. If a railroad slipped below its class qualification threshold for a period, it was not necessarily demoted immediately.
